A 2024 Smartly.io survey found that 48% of advertisers reported better results when humans and AI collaborated on ad management, versus only 13% who preferred fully automated AI management. This sounds like a win for human agencies — but the real insight is more nuanced.

The 48% who succeeded with human-AI collaboration were using AI as a tireless execution layer while humans provided strategic guardrails and creative direction.

The agency inconsistency problem: Many agencies rotate account managers every 6–12 months. When your person leaves, institutional knowledge walks out the door. Your new account manager spends 3 months learning your business — during which your campaigns drift.

The AI consistency advantage: Didoo AI maintains your rules, your preferences, your brand voice, and your optimization history indefinitely. There’s no institutional knowledge loss.

The key insight: AI media buyers excel at optimization within defined parameters. Traditional agencies excel at strategic judgment in novel situations.

For SMBs running established campaigns on Meta and Google, 80% of the work is optimization within parameters — exactly what AI does best.


The Human-AI Division of Labor: What Goes Where?

Tasks AI handles better (give to Didoo AI):

  • Daily bid adjustments based on cost-per-result targets
  • Audience fatigue detection and automatic refresh
  • Creative combination testing at scale (10+ variations simultaneously)
  • Budget allocation across ad sets based on real-time ROAS
  • Conversion tracking setup and monitoring (Meta Pixel, CAPI)
  • Reporting and performance summaries
  • Pause/start decisions when thresholds are crossed

Tasks humans handle better (your focus):

  • Defining the offer and value proposition
  • Setting strategic business goals (target ROAS, lifetime value assumptions)
  • Approving major budget changes or new campaign directions
  • Creative direction — what story to tell, what emotion to target
  • Responding to competitive landscape changes
  • Interpreting customer feedback that should change strategy

What is an AI media buyer?

An AI media buyer is software that uses artificial intelligence to manage digital advertising campaigns automatically. It handles audience targeting, bid optimization, budget allocation, and creative testing without human intervention.
